SUBJECT

Title
Authorize a fourth amendment to the Tax Increment Development, Chapter 380 Grant, and Chapter 380 Loan Agreement ("2018 TIF/Chapter 380 Agreement") with WCWRD Inc and its affiliates or subsidiaries ("Developer"), approved as to form by the City Attorney, related to the Reimagine RedBird Mall Redevelopment Project ("Project"), now known as the Shops at RedBird, generally located at the southeast corner of Camp Wisdom Road and Westmoreland Road in the Mall Area Redevelopment TIF District, specifically including modifications to Section 2.C(7), Section 2.D(2), and Section 5.E as further described below, and any modifications to any other associated Project documents as may be necessary to effectuate the specific modifications described below; and as consideration for the fourth amendment, increase the Developer's minimum Investment Requirement by $15,000,000.00 for the Project from $135,000,000.00 to $150,000,000.00 - Financing: No cost consideration to the City

Body
BACKGROUND

Since the 2018 TIF/Chapter 380 Agreement with the Developer was authorized by City Council in June 2018, the Developer has continued to make substantial progress on the Project, now known as Shops at RedBird, generally located at the southeast corner of Camp Wisdom Road and Westmoreland Road in the Mall Area TIF District.

In February 2024, the Developer submitted a request for three relatively minor amendments to the 2018 TIF/Chapter 380 Agreement to address an issue arising over the past few years mostly due to the COVID-19 pandemic and its lasting impact on shifting market demand for certain Project elements that had been contemplated in 2017-2018 when the terms and conditions of the 2018 TIF/Chapter 380 Agreement were originally negotiated.
